IC (LM358):

The LM358 is an integrated circuit (IC) that contains two operational amplifiers. It’s commonly used in electronic circuits for amplification, signal conditioning, and various other applications. This IC is versatile, low-cost, and widely available, making it popular among hobbyists and professionals alike. Its dual operational amplifier design allows it to handle multiple tasks within a circuit, often involving amplification or signal processing.

Moisture sensor:

A moisture sensor is a device that measures the moisture content in soil, allowing you to monitor the level of water present. It typically consists of two electrodes that are inserted into the soil. As the soil moisture changes, the electrical conductivity between these electrodes also changes. This change in conductivity is then measured by the sensor and converted into a signal that indicates the moisture level.

Regulator (7805):

The 7805 is a voltage regulator IC that provides a stable output voltage of +5 volts. It’s part of the 78xx series of voltage regulators, known for their ability to regulate and maintain a constant voltage output despite fluctuations in input voltage or load variations.

Diod (4007):

1N4007 is a general-purpose silicon rectifier diode. It’s part of the 1N400x series of diodes and is widely used in various electronic circuits due to its ability to handle moderate levels of current and voltage.

The 1N4007 diode is typically used in rectification applications, where it allows current to flow in only one direction while blocking it in the reverse direction. It’s commonly employed in power supply circuits to convert alternating current (AC) to direct current (DC) by allowing current flow in only one direction.
